The Nike CEO Lacrosse Head: A Game-Changing Innovation
In 2008, Nike introduced a lacrosse head that would forever change the sport. The Nike CEO lacrosse head, named after then-CEO Mark Parker, quickly became a legend among players at all levels. What made this head so revolutionary?
The Nike CEO head featured a wider face shape, decreased sidewall flare, and strategically placed stringing holes. These design elements combined to offer superior ball control, enhanced scooping ability, and unparalleled accuracy in passing and shooting. The patent-pending sidewall rail design maintained stiffness and durability while reducing flare.
Attackmen found the CEO head’s pinpoint precision invaluable for shots, while face-off specialists benefited from its widened scoop and rounded shape near the throat. The head’s versatility made it a top choice for players across positions, from youth leagues to professional teams.

Even as new products entered the market, the Nike CEO head retained its popularity. Its intelligent features and commitment to quality and style set a new standard for lacrosse equipment. More than a decade after its introduction, players still rely on this classic design to elevate their game.
Nike Arise: Pushing Boundaries with Composite Technology
In 2021, Nike once again revolutionized the lacrosse equipment industry with the introduction of the Arise lacrosse stick. This innovative composite stick represents a significant leap forward in stick technology. How does the Arise stick improve upon traditional designs?
The Arise stick utilizes a proprietary composite material in both the handle and head. This advanced material offers an optimal balance of stiffness, strength, and flex, enhancing ball feel and shooting performance. The composite head maintains structural integrity while allowing for some flex during passing and catching, while the handle reduces weight without sacrificing essential stiffness.

Nike’s engineers strategically placed the composite material to maximize its benefits. High-stress areas of the handle contain composite for increased durability, while the head features composite around the scoop, sidewalls, and brace for improved stiffness and strength. This thoughtful design reduces overall weight without compromising ball control and handling.
Additional Technologies in the Arise Stick
- Flyrail sidewalls: Increase ball friction for excellent hold during shooting and passing
- Hyperforce stringing holes: Allow for customized pocket styles, optimizing ball control
The combination of these features results in a revolutionary stick that offers precise performance, lightweight feel, and pinpoint shooting accuracy. The Arise stick quickly gained popularity among players, cementing Nike’s reputation for cutting-edge innovation in lacrosse equipment.

Understanding Nike’s Lacrosse Stick Technology

Behind Nike’s cutting-edge lacrosse sticks is a range of advanced technologies engineered to optimize performance. From composite materials to head designs, Nike utilizes innovative tech to create high-performance lacrosse equipment.
One key technology is the use of composite materials in shafts and heads. Nike engineered proprietary composite formulas to achieve new levels of stiffness, strength, and reduced weight. Strategically placed composites boost durability while removing unnecessary mass. The result is ultra-responsive, lightweight sticks.
Nike’s head shapes also utilize tech-driven designs. Using computer modeling and player feedback, Nike optimizes the scoop, sidewall height, channel width, and other structural features to improve handling. For example, the widened scoop on heads like the CEO facilitates easier ground ball pickup.
Stringing hole patterns represent another technical innovation from Nike. Through lab testing, Nike develops stringing holes that allow customizable pocket creation for ideal ball control and release. The Hyperforce stringing system in heads like the Alpha Huarache optimizes string placement.
Nike’s shaft technologies also seek to amplify feel and quickness. The Tri-Flex composite handle uses three composite pieces joined through a unique process to improve flex and handling. Meanwhile, the rubberized Pro Tip end provides excellent control and durability on face-offs.
From lab to field, Nike’s commitment to technical innovation pushes lacrosse equipment performance forward. The brand’s expertise in advanced engineering and design translates into sticks with game-changing technologies and capabilities for all positions and skill levels.

Lacrosse Head Shapes and Styles by Nike

To meet every player’s needs across positions and skill levels, Nike offers a diverse lineup of lacrosse head shapes and styles. The company utilizes advanced engineering to optimize each head’s capabilities.
For offensive players, heads like the Alpha Huarache have narrowed channel widths and mid-height sidewalls for excellent ball control and pinpoint shooting. The legacy Vapor head also provides a quick-release, accurate shot with its elite-level design.
In the midfield category, heads like the Command and CEO offer wider faces for scooping ground balls and passing in transition. Their lower sidewalls and rounded scoops facilitate handling and passing at high speeds.
On defense, Nike’s Nemesis and Legacy heads provide maximum stiffness for checking. Their flared sidewalls and angled scoops help defenders protect their goal. For face-off specialists, the CEO and Swarm heads optimize ground ball pickups.
For goalies, Nike designs heads like the Nemesis and Avatar with extra-wide faces to improve saving percentage. The increased surface area and stiff sidewalls enhance blocking and clearing ability.
Across all positions, Nike utilizes lab testing, on-field player trials, and data analysis to engineer heads that maximize key performance factors. With cutting-edge technologies like Hyperforce stringing holes, Nike’s head shapes cater to each athlete’s needs at the highest level.
